LB Showroom: Mr. Wang Adds On - Not Bad

Alexander Wang has been considered one of the most well put together "ready-to-wear" brands that presents at Fashion week and I pretty much have to agree. With his accolades and success being in order he has decided to add and make a few changes to his "simple" yet thriving empire.
Parting ways with his creative director (Erin Wasson) of two years, Wang picked up Alastair McKimm to style his Spring 2009 collection in place of Wasson. Alexander promises a newer and more FUN line for 2009.

"There will be lots of color and dresses, an athletic-meets-“Miami Vice” vibe, lace patterns inspired by sweat stains, and runway hats by milliner Albertus Swanepoel that look like a mix between swim caps and “corseted do-rags". Wang explained.

Also with the change up he is implementing a tee-shirt line (T by Alexander Wang) and his very first shoe line. Tanks to T-shirt dresses will range from ($28-$40 wholesale) in colors ranging from whites and gray to lavender, chartreuse and cerulean, all in Alex's signature slouchy and over-sized style. The shoes give me a very dark and racy feel that I feel would complement his additions very well. There are five styles to begin with ranging from $125 to $250 wholesale.
